Output e233df6ea9ad21ee31903dfc19e7a3119200f7e711bc0ceccbc4e2c2f2a37015:0

value
17654387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c9dbd6f312b990897419eb905f0c7fd6988f81 OP_EQUAL
address
3DtRcSzUKmf6v83fsUEcwMkYAEr1WWmq5x
transaction
e233df6ea9ad21ee31903dfc19e7a3119200f7e711bc0ceccbc4e2c2f2a37015
confirmations
473244
spent
true